Technical Specifications & HIPS Granules Properties
| Property | Virgin General Purpose | Virgin High Impact | Recycled Standard | Recycled Premium | Food Grade | Flame Retardant |
|---|---|---|---|---|---|---|
| Melt Flow Index (g/10min) | 3-8 | 2-6 | 4-10 | 3-7 | 3-6 | 2-5 |
| Density (g/cm³) | 1.04-1.06 | 1.03-1.05 | 1.04-1.07 | 1.04-1.06 | 1.04-1.05 | 1.08-1.12 |
| Tensile Strength (MPa) | 30-40 | 25-35 | 25-35 | 28-38 | 32-42 | 28-38 |
| Elongation at Break (%) | 25-50 | 30-60 | 20-45 | 25-50 | 30-55 | 25-45 |
| Flexural Strength (MPa) | 45-65 | 40-55 | 35-50 | 40-58 | 48-68 | 42-58 |
| Flexural Modulus (GPa) | 2.0-2.8 | 1.8-2.5 | 1.6-2.3 | 1.8-2.6 | 2.2-3.0 | 2.0-2.7 |
| Impact Strength (kJ/m²) | 8-15 | 12-25 | 6-12 | 10-18 | 10-18 | 8-15 |
| Hardness (Shore D) | 75-85 | 70-80 | 70-82 | 72-84 | 78-88 | 74-84 |
| Heat Deflection Temperature (°C) | 75-85 | 70-80 | 65-78 | 70-82 | 80-90 | 85-95 |
| Vicat Softening Point (°C) | 95-105 | 90-100 | 85-98 | 90-102 | 100-110 | 105-115 |
| Processing Temperature (°C) | 180-220 | 180-220 | 180-230 | 180-225 | 185-225 | 190-240 |
| Mold Temperature (°C) | 40-80 | 40-80 | 40-85 | 40-82 | 45-85 | 50-90 |
| Shrinkage (%) | 0.4-0.8 | 0.5-0.9 | 0.5-1.0 | 0.4-0.9 | 0.3-0.7 | 0.4-0.8 |
| Water Absorption (%) | 0.05-0.15 | 0.08-0.18 | 0.08-0.20 | 0.06-0.16 | 0.04-0.12 | 0.06-0.16 |
| Chemical Resistance | Excellent to acids/alkalis | Excellent to acids/alkalis | Good to acids/alkalis | Excellent to acids/alkalis | Excellent | Good to Excellent |
| UV Resistance | Moderate | Moderate | Limited | Moderate | Good | Moderate |
| Transparency | Opaque | Opaque | Opaque | Opaque | Opaque | Opaque |
| Color Options | Natural, White, Black, Custom | Natural, White, Black, Custom | Grey, Black, Mixed | Natural, White, Black | Natural, White | Various |
| Rubber Content (%) | 5-8 | 8-15 | 4-10 | 6-12 | 6-10 | 8-12 |
| Volatile Content (%) | <0.5 | <0.5 | <0.8 | <0.6 | <0.3 | <0.5 |
| Ash Content (%) | <0.3 | <0.3 | 0.5-2.0 | <0.8 | <0.2 | 0.5-3.0 |
| Pellet Size (mm) | 2-4 | 2-4 | 2-5 | 2-4 | 2-3 | 2-4 |
| Bulk Density (g/cm³) | 0.50-0.65 | 0.48-0.62 | 0.45-0.60 | 0.48-0.63 | 0.52-0.67 | 0.55-0.70 |
| Processing Method | Injection molding, thermoforming, extrusion | |||||
| Recyclability | 100% recyclable | 100% recyclable | Already recycled | 100% recyclable | 100% recyclable | Limited recyclability |
| Storage Conditions | Cool, dry, ventilated environment | |||||
| Shelf Life | 2-3 years | |||||
| Packaging Options | 25kg bags, 1000kg big bags, bulk containers |

Quality Control & Testing Procedures
Comprehensive Quality Assurance Every production batch undergoes extensive testing to ensure compliance with plastics standards, food contact regulations, and international quality requirements. Our quality control laboratory employs advanced analytical techniques including mechanical testing, thermal analysis, and chemical composition evaluation. High Impact Polystyrene consists of polystyrene matrix reinforced with rubber particles to enhance impact resistance and toughness.
Quality assurance procedures include:
- Melt flow index testing using capillary rheometer
- Tensile strength testing using universal testing machine
- Impact strength testing using Izod/Charpy methods
- Flexural properties testing using three-point bending
- Heat deflection temperature using HDT apparatus
- Vicat softening point using penetration method
- Density measurement using displacement method
- Chemical resistance testing using immersion method
- Color measurement using spectrophotometer
- Particle size analysis using sieve analysis
- Moisture content testing using Karl Fischer method
- Ash content determination using muffle furnace
- Volatile content analysis using thermogravimetric analysis
- Processing performance evaluation using injection molding trials
- Food contact compliance verification using migration tests
- Environmental stress cracking resistance testing
- Quality consistency monitoring using statistical process control
